Abstract

Intravascular papillary endothelial hyperplasia is a rare benign lesion of vascular origin. Histologically, it mimics angiosarcoma and needs to be differentiated from the latter as the treatment and prognosis differ. We report a case of 21-year-old female with intravascular papillary endothelial hyperplasia of left antecubital vein having a history of a longstanding indwelling intravenous catheter. On review of the literature, we did not find any report of an endothelial hyperplasia being caused by intravenous line left in situ for a prolonged interval of time.
